Shoulder joint

SHOULDER JOINT

Ox

  • It is an enarthrosis formed between the glenoid cavity of the scapula and the head of the humerus.
    • Ligaments
      • Capsular ligament is the only ligament, which is loose and is protected by the several muscles of the shoulder around the joint.
      • The position of the joints not fixed because both the bones can move.
    • Motion
      • Polyaxial. Extension and flexion are best marked. Adduction and abduction and circumduction are also present.

Horse

  • No difference.

Dog

  • The rim of the glenoid cavity is raised by a marginal cartilage.
